Comparison of the effectiveness of lifestyle interventions and multi-interventional therapy on biochemical parameters of metabolic syndrome among women.

Abstract

BACKGROUND

Metabolic syndrome is one of the emerging health issues in developing countries. It includes diabetes, high blood pressure, obesity, and elevated blood cholesterol. This study aimed to compare the effects of two different types of interventions: multi-interventional therapy (MIT) and lifestyle interventions (LIs) on high-density lipoprotein (HDL), triglycerides, and fasting blood sugar (FBS) among women with metabolic syndrome.

MATERIALS AND METHODS

The study used a quasi-experimental nonequivalent control group design with two experimental groups and one control group. This study was conducted among self-help group women from nine area development societies (ADS) in a selected area in South India from March 1, 2019, to February 28, 2020. Women (aged between 35 and 55 years) with metabolic syndrome were recruited by multistage sampling ( = 220) and randomly assigned into three groups: (a) control, (b) MIT (intervention 1), and (c) LIs (intervention 2). Reflexology foot massage, dietary modification, moderate-intensity exercise, and structured education were given to the MIT group and dietary modification, moderate-intensity exercise, and structured education were given to the LI group for 12 weeks. The control group received routine care. A demographic and clinical data sheet is used to collect the basic information. Biochemical variables (HDL, triglycerides, and FBS) were assessed before and after the intervention. The data obtained from the study were computed using a frequency distribution to describe the demographic characteristics, and a Chi-square (x) test was conducted to find the homogeneity. Both parametric and nonparametric tests were conducted for the comparison of the effectiveness of different methods of interventions on biochemical parameters of metabolic syndrome.

RESULTS

Women who received MIT and LI had significantly lower values of HDL, triglycerides, and FBS after the treatment from baseline and compared with the control group. The study found a significant improvement in the biochemical parameters in the MIT group as compared to the control group and the LI group (<0.001).

CONCLUSION

Paired -test shows significant improvement in HDL, triglycerides, and FBS ( < 0.001) in both the LI and MIT groups. In case of triglycerides, MIT was found to be more effective ( < 0.001). Both MIT and LIs can be considered interventions for reducing triglycerides and FBS and increasing HDL.

摘要

背景

代谢综合征是发展中国家新出现的健康问题之一。它包括糖尿病、高血压、肥胖和血液胆固醇升高。本研究旨在比较两种不同类型的干预措施:多干预疗法(MIT)和生活方式干预(LIs)对代谢综合征女性高密度脂蛋白(HDL)、甘油三酯和空腹血糖(FBS)的影响。

材料与方法

本研究采用准实验非等效对照组设计,设有两个实验组和一个对照组。本研究于2019年3月1日至2020年2月28日在印度南部某选定地区的九个地区发展协会(ADS)的自助组女性中进行。通过多阶段抽样招募了患有代谢综合征的女性(年龄在35至55岁之间,n = 220),并将她们随机分为三组:(a)对照组,(b)MIT(干预1),和(c)LIs(干预2)。对MIT组进行反射疗法足部按摩、饮食调整、中等强度运动和结构化教育,对LIs组进行饮食调整、中等强度运动和结构化教育,为期12周。对照组接受常规护理。使用人口统计学和临床数据表收集基本信息。在干预前后评估生化变量(HDL、甘油三酯和FBS)。从研究中获得的数据使用频率分布进行计算以描述人口统计学特征,并进行卡方(χ)检验以发现同质性。对不同干预方法对代谢综合征生化参数的有效性进行比较时,同时进行了参数检验和非参数检验。

结果

接受MIT和LIs的女性在治疗后与基线相比以及与对照组相比,HDL、甘油三酯和FBS的值显著降低。研究发现,与对照组和LIs组相比,MIT组的生化参数有显著改善(P<0.001)。

结论

配对t检验显示,LIs组和MIT组的HDL、甘油三酯和FBS均有显著改善(P < 0.001)。在甘油三酯方面,发现MIT更有效(P < 0.001)。MIT和LIs均可被视为降低甘油三酯和FBS以及提高HDL的干预措施。
